About agriculture in Palenque
Palenque is situated in the heart of the Guantánamo province, nestled within the rugged and lush landscapes of eastern Cuba. Surrounded by the foothills of the Sagua-Baracoa mountain range, the area is characterized by dense tropical vegetation and fertile soil. The rural scenery is dominated by green hills and winding valleys that define the unique topography of this Caribbean region.
The agricultural profile of Palenque is centered on mountain crops, with coffee being the primary commercial product. The high altitude and humid climate provide ideal conditions for cultivating high-quality coffee beans and cocoa. Additionally, local farms produce significant quantities of bananas, citrus fruits, and various tubers, which are essential for both local consumption and regional trade.
